The ONESTEP GENERATOR automatically creates validation protocol document content and provides version control and change tracking features, which aid compliance with the new 21CFR11 regulations. Component-based development is at the core of ONESTEP GENERATOR applications. It enables new applications to be created by configuring within the tool's process analysis view using libraries of process objects such as pumps, drives and valves. The creation of process control system applications for reusable parts is the next great wave in software engineering for the process industries. Fully compatible with the ANSI-S88 standard for batch process control, ONESTEP GENERATOR is a tool that manages the process control system application throughout the software life cycle. By providing a uniform platform for system design and component specification, ONESTEP GENERATOR facilitates a common design methodology among all engineering staff and others involved in process design, regardless of discipline. It enables everyone involved in a project to define the requirements of the process, minimizing software mistakes and reducing both implementation cycle times, engineering and validation costs.
